Once Upon A Time
Jared S. Gilmore as Henryand Colin O'Donoghue as Captain Hook in Once Upon A Time season 6 episode 3.ABC

Once Upon A Time season 6 returns with episode 3 this Sunday, October 9, at 8pm EST on ABC Networks. The sequel is titled The Other Shoe and it will focus on Regina Mills and her new move against the evil queen.

Click here to watch the episode live online to find out what is next in store for Emma Swan, Captain Hook, Snow White, Prince Charles, Bella, Mr. Gold and Henry. The sequel will also be available online on ABC Go.

In the sequel, actress Jessy Schram of Veronica Mars will reprise her role as Ashley Boyd a.k.a Cinderella. According to the official synopsis, the character will return to Storybrooke in search of her step-family in order to settle their unfinished business.

While Jennifer Morrison's character reunites with her boyfriend and son to help the fairytale character, her mom will join hands with Dr. Jekyll to find a suitable laboratory for his work.

In the meantime, Lana Parrilla's character will plan her next move against the evil queen and try to bribe Mr Hyde for information on how to defeat her alter-ego.

On the other hand, David Nolan will make a deal with Mr Gold and deliver a message to Belle in exchange for new information about his father. In flashback, Cinderella attends a ball and meets her prince.

The brief summary of upcoming episode also hints at troubled moments for the heroes and it read: As Storybrooke continues to welcome the new arrivals from the Land of Untold Stories, families, friends and even long-lost enemies are reunited once again.

Meanwhile, Once Upon A Time season 6 episode 4 is titled Strange Case and the official synopsis of it is yet to be released. Watch the trailers of episode 3, The Other Shoe below: